Biography
Associate Professor of Business Administration Erika H. James teaches First Year Leading Organizations at Darden. She continues to conduct research in the areas of crisis leadership and workforce diversity and has published in several leading academic journals including Strategic Management Journal, Organization Science, Journal of Applied Psychology, and Academy of Management Journal. Executive summaries of her published journal articles may be viewed on her Web site, www.erikahayesjames.com/journal-articles. Her research on crisis leadership is also evident in her upcoming new book, Leading Under Pressure: From Surviving to Thriving Before, During, and After a Crisis which is expected to be published early 2010.
In her work with executives she conducts seminars or consults on how to make decisions under pressure and how to build trust in the workplace. And she has impacted several Fortune 500 companies such as Intel, Freddie Mac, Johnson & Johnson, Bayer Pharmaceuticals, Merrill Lynch, and Farmers Insurance.
James joined the Darden faculty in 2001. In addition to teaching, she pioneered a new position at DardenAssociate Dean of Diversity, in order to create a more diverse and inclusive environment for faculty and students. Prior to this appointment she served on the faculty at the Freeman School of Business at Tulane University and the Goizuetta Business School at Emory University.
